Wiggins embraces first Death Valley experience and Tiger fans

Freshman defensive back Korrin Wiggins played in the first game he has ever seen live from Clemson's Death Valley, and came away feeling "honored" after the experience. What does he say about Clemson fans? What was running down the hill like? Full Story »

I was fortunate enough to stand in line with this young man's family during the fan appreciation event. They were A+ folks. It is obvious where he gets his attitude from. His dad said it came down to us and Ohio St for Korrin. After his last visit here, he said it was the obvious choice for him. His grandparents were there also and had great things to say about Clemson. When we met him, he had a big smile and shook hands with my 7 year old son and took a picture with him. I was very glad to see him play on Saturday. He is gonna be a great player to watch. Very glad to have new guys like him in our program. He is also a pretty dang good football player. That was a great tackle for loss he had.
